I am a composer for advertising and film, a performer and educator. Throughout my career, an all-consuming passion for music has inspired me to explore many areas of the world of music.

After graduating Mannes College of Music with a degree in composition I worked as a senior staff writer for David Horowitz Music Associates, one of the leading music production companies in New York. During my tenure there I composed, arranged, orchestrated and conducted music for hundreds of spots. My eclectic musical background enabled me to compose music in all styles from large orchestral works to rock, pop and jazz for top shelf clients such as American Airlines, Mercedes, Visa, Pepsi, GE, KFC, Lincoln Mercury, FedEx, Met Life, John Hancock, and Verizon among others. I garnered  AICP, Clio, Effie, and Mobius awards along the way and my music was featured at Cannes, the Superbowl and at the Paley Center for Media. I worked on various projects for Phillip Glass.

I performed on guitar with artists as diverse as Blue Lou Marini from the Blues Brothers, Glen Branca, the Yale Jazz Ensemble, the Big Apple Circus at Lincoln Center, and Bang on a Can All Stars.

Recent projects include: creating and composing music for the theater/music work in progress, Etty Hillesum: The Thinking Heart of the Barracks; co-composed incidental music for the documentary film about restorative justice, Unguarded https://www.unguardedmovie.com/; co-composed music forThe Girl From Hong Kong, an exhibit featured at the Meeting for the Friendship of Peoples, Rimini, Italy; produced and composed The Psalms, a collaborative effort, featuring 6 international composers, performed at the New York Encounter at the Metropolitan Pavilion; and co-composed the soundtrack to Humans and Trees, a feature film directed by John Touhey.

Upcoming projects include Song of Hannah, a work for soprano and string quartet and The Canticle of Zechariah, for chorus.
